I have a 1990 NC30 which strangely will not run when the fuel level gets below around half a tank. It is completely standard. When I bought the bike it had a performance end can on and a dynojet kit and I have jetted it back to original spec and fitted a standard exhaust. I have had the carbs off and fully cleaned, I have put new plugs in, new air filter, checked the fuel tap diaphragm and actually removed it temporarily to eliminate that, checked the fuel tap for blockage and I am now at a loss as to what is causing the problem. Has anyone else come across this problem?? I will be really grateful for any ideas that anyone would have as to what the problem could be.
